endured

英 [ɪnˈdjʊəd]

美 [ɪnˈdʊrd]

v.  忍耐; 忍受; 持续; 持久
endure的过去分词和过去式

柯林斯词典

  • VERB 忍耐;忍受
    If youendurea painful or difficult situation, you experience it and do not avoid it or give up, usually because you cannot.
    1. The company endured heavy financial losses.
      那家公司遭受了严重亏损。
    2. ...unbearable pain, which they had to endure in solitude because not even the doctors could get near them.
      他们不得不独自承受的无法忍受的疼痛,因为甚至连医生都无法靠近他们
  • VERB 持续;持久
    If somethingendures, it continues to exist without any loss in quality or importance.
    1. Somehow the language endures and continues to survive.
      那种语言以某种方式保存下来,并继续存在下去。

双语例句

  • He endured cold and hunger.
    他忍受着寒冷与饥饿。
  • He endured hardships to plan retaliation.
    他卧薪尝胆,图谋报复。
  • Until I emigrated to America, my family and I endured progressive ostracism and discrimination.
    我的家庭和我自己忍受着变本加厉的排斥和歧视直到我移居美国。
  • She endured the monstrous behaviour for years
    多年来,她一直忍受着这种骇人听闻的暴行。
  • All had endured a chronic, persistent cough for more than three months.
    所有患者都忍受了超过3个月的慢性持续性咳嗽。
  • What the Palestinians have endured and continue to endure.
    巴勒斯坦的忍耐和持续的忍耐。
  • We have endured a long and painful recession.
    我们经历了漫长而痛苦的经济衰退。
  • He also talked briefly about the isolation he endured while in captivity.
    他还简单谈及了他被俘期间忍受的孤独。
  • All the major powers involved endured enormous costs and the loss of thousands of lives.
    所有参与其中的主要力量都承受了巨大的损失,牺牲了无数人的生命。
